Software Reviews of Earth Global Explorer 1.0Customer Review: Eartha Global Explorer Inferior to Original Global Explorer Summary: 2 Stars
DeLorme's Eartha Global Explorer 1.0 is not at all like its predecessor, Global Explorer 1.0. The original Global Explorer had street maps of the world's great cities, with detailed descriptions of famous landmarks, like a wonderful tour of the world. The new 'Eartha' Global Explorer has none of those features and seems to be nothing more than a crude attempt at an annotated 3-D atlas of the world, viewed from afar. I tried to order the original Global Explorer, without success.
Description of Earth Global Explorer 1.0Back in the good old days, world explorers needed to carry tons of food, gear, and malaria pills; these days you can go anywhere using just a notebook computer in the local coffee shop and Eartha Global Explorer 1.0. Using high-detail satellite imagery and up-to-date political and transportation information, users can find the facts on locations from Manhattan to Madagascar and practically anywhere else. The interface is easy to navigate; users just enter a place name or browse the world map from nearly any height. Those who want to leave their armchairs will find travel planning a breeze as well, with highway, air, rail, and even ferry travel data wired in or available online; any trip imaginable, short of hot-air ballooning, can be planned in seconds. Users can change any leg of the trip in accordance with particular needs, including sightseeing, efficiency, or sticking to particular routes. Floyd, DeLorme's guide, offers tips and facts about locations worldwide in a manner that's far less obnoxious than his virtual cousins, and the terminally impatient can turn him off at their whim. While it doesn't offer the comprehensive demographic and geographic data of a good atlas, the combination of browsing and trip-planning capabilities makes Eartha Global Explorer 1.0 worth attention.
